The Communications Tower is a structure on the Rocket Island. In the beginning of Act 3 the tower needs to be repaired with an Advanced Wiring Kit and the Ship Wreck Salvage from the Crashed Ship part in the Tree Spires.

Old now due to Frostbite Update. Vesper is now a Sentinel. In Experimental, the tower is placed by new Radio Tower which needs to be sabotaged by reprogramming it with a Test Override Module, crafted using blueprints found in the Crashed Ship.

Trivia

  • Using the command resourcesfor rocketradiotower will give the player both ingredients required to repair the tower.
  • The Communications Tower was originally called "Radio Tower 7" in earlier versions of the game.
